SUPPLY and SERVICE CONTRACT Page 4 of 7 GENERAL CONDITIONS INSURANCE
II. B. Workers Compensation Insurance: Prior to the execution of this contract, the Contractor shall procure Workers Compensation Insurance in accord with the Laws of the State of New York, without regard to jurisdiction, on behalf of all employees who are to provide labor or service under this contract.
If leased employees are to be used under this contract, contractor shall furnish copy of lease agreement to the Department’s Contract Management Office, together with confirmation of New York mandated endorsements to Workers Compensation policies of contractors and leasing company. Prior to starting work, a list of all leased employees shall be furnished to the Department’s Project Manager for this contract.
Two certificates of such insurance SLat for self-insurance shall be furnished to the Contract Management Office.
II. C. Collision Liability/Towers Liability: American Institute Tug Form - February 1,1976 - or equivalent - as respects all tugs used under this contract; collision liability per American institute Hull clauses June 2,1977, lines 158 -184 as respects other vessels used in connection with this contract.
II. D. Employers Liability Insurance: Before performing any work on the Contract, the Contractor shall procure Employers Liability Insurance affording compensation for all employees providing labor or services for whom Workers Compensation coverage is not a statutory lequirement.
Two certificates of such insurance shall be furnished to the Contract Management Office.
Certificates confirming renewals of insurance shall be presented to the Contract Management Ofrce not less than 30 days prior to the expiration date of coverage, until all operations under this contract are deemed completed.
li. E. Jones-Act: For compensation to all crew members In the event of injury suffered in the course of operations under this contract if not provided under Workers Compensation Insurance or under Marine Protection and Indemnity: the Contractor shall present, to the Contract Management Office, satisfactory evidence of insurance or other financial security acceptable to the Department. Self-insurance shall not exceed $500,000.
DEP SUPPLY & SERVICE INSURANCE PROVISIONS: January 24.1998
